The Challenge

Applying for small business loans can feel clinical and overwhelming, making users hesitant to share financial details online. The platform needed to immediately establish rock-solid credibility to maximize lead capture. The main design and technical puzzle here was balancing two competing needs: providing enough transparent info on loan criteria to build trust, while keeping the layout streamlined enough to guide users toward the intake form without causing application fatigue.

The Approach & UX Solution

Instead of throwing a cold lead capture form at users the second they land on the page, I designed a value-first acquisition funnel.

  • Humanizing the Brand: I started from scratch by designing a custom logo and visual identity. I paired a clean, modern layout with vibrant photography of real industries to make the business funding space feel approachable and human rather than corporate.
  • Progressive Content Flow: As small business owners scroll, the page serves up bite-sized blocks of information detailing loan benefits, qualification parameters, and funding speeds. This deliberate breakdown answers borrower doubts before asking for their data.
  • Frictionless Data Collection: The page builds up to a prominent, clear Call to Action. I designed the multi-step loan intake form to capture essential business data in logical, low-stress stages, keeping abandonment low and completion rates high.

Technical Execution

With paid traffic and lead conversion performance on the line, I skipped heavy libraries and went back to the fundamentals to keep things lean and fast.

  • Lightweight Modular Architecture: Used PHP for clean, server-side page templating. This kept the codebase dry and manageable while ensuring zero client-side rendering overhead for incoming mobile traffic.
  • Vanilla JS Validation: Wrote custom JavaScript to handle real-time form validation on the intake fields. It gives users instant, helpful feedback as they input financial details—preventing broken lead submissions without adding the weight of a third-party form library.
  • Responsive layouts: Crafted the HTML and CSS from the ground up with a mobile-first mindset, ensuring the multi-step loan questionnaire is just as easy to tap through on a phone as it is on a desktop.
